2. Parks and Enrichment Services
a. PROS Plan approval Timeline:
Reviewed the need for a Parks, Recreation, and Open Space Plan
Provides 6-year guide or managing Parks and Enrichment
Services Department
State certified making the City eligible for State RCO grants
Reviewed the steps that have gone into building the plan
Assessment & inventory of all parks, trails, and open space
property
Updated City’s demographics
Community Engagement – surveys, focus groups, open house
workshop
Capital project review
Implementation and funding strategies
Plan review and approval
Timeline
January – RCO reviewed draft plan and all required elements
are covered in the proposed plan
February – Public Hearing at Planning Commission

March - Public Hearing at City Council & send to Recreation and
Conservation Office at the State for final approval
b. Park Deferred Maintenance Grant Update: Parks received a $99,300
Deferred Maintenance Grant through the Washington State
Recreation and Conservation Office
c. Edgewater Park Fields Update: The Parks crew is installing an
irrigated soccer field at Hillcrest Park and a renovated multipurpose
(soccer and baseball) field at Edgewater Park
The Hillcrest field will be open for the public use later this summer
and work on the Edgewater Field will begin this summer.
d. Illuminight Event: The event is at 5pm January 26th at the
Riverwalk Plaza. Booths and entertainment begin at 5pm and the
Walk begins at 6pm
e. Recreation Update:
Summer program planning is underway
New – Birdwatchers Club, Touch A Truck Event and Hillcrest
Park 100 Year Anniversary Celebration
Returning – Outdoor Nature Camps and Programming,
Supervised Playground, and Rec on the Go programs
3. Finance
a. 2022 Financial Audit: An overview of the State Auditor’s Office
audit process, types of audits, and draft information regarding the
outcome of the 2022 audit was presented. A tentative exit
conference with the SAO is scheduled for January 30th.
b. Mount Vernon Library Commons Financial Update: Provided an
updated spreadsheet with the committed revenue sources as of this
date. The City received a $12.5M grant from the Federal
Community Charging Program spearheaded by Representative Rick
Larsen. Mr. Volesky discussed some of the decisions that now need
to be made regarding the amount of the TIFIA loan, overall project
costs, and city used revenue sources. An update on the TIFIA loan
was provided. A draft report on the 2023 sales tax revenues was
presented. As of the end of December, the City received
$9,994,929. This represents a 4% increase over the 2022 amount
and was almost $800K over the 2023 budgeted amount.
